mySQL로 함수작성 후 프로시저 실행하기

MySQL에서 함수를 작성한 후, CREATE PROCEDURE 문으로 프로시저를 만들고 CALL 문으로 실행하여 원하는 작업 수행

MySQL에서 함수를 만들고 프로시저를 실행하는 과정은 매우 간단합니다. 먼저, 원하는 데이터베이스에 연결하는 것으로 시작합니다. 그 다음에는 CREATE FUNCTION 문을 사용하여 필요한 작업을 수행할 함수를 정의합니다. 이 함수는 매개변수를 받아 특정 작업을 수행하고 결과를 반환하는 구조입니다.

함수를 만들고 나면, 이제 프로시저를 작성할 차례입니다. 프로시저는 여러 SQL 문을 한 번에 실행할 수 있게 해주는 집합으로, CREATE PROCEDURE 문을 사용해 만들게 됩니다. 여기서 함수 호출도 가능하므로 필요한 계산이나 데이터 가공을 쉽게 수행할 수 있습니다.

프로시저가 준비되면, CALL 문을 사용해 실행할 수 있습니다. 이때, 프로시저가 입력값을 필요로 한다면 그 값을 함께 제공해야 합니다. 실행이 끝난 후에는 결과를 확인하고, 원하는 대로 잘 나왔는지 점검하게 됩니다. 마지막으로, 결과가 마음에 들지 않는 경우 함수나 프로시저의 코드를 수정하여 더 나은 결과를 얻을 수 있습니다.